Output 33bfd515106a37effbbc4859d5eceb3a5fcb3f8557abd1412e8a2d86e42a0394:2

value
35014238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 563aaaaa0fa9d7c3538fb8a3a8e82a86e57efb3c OP_EQUAL
address
MFm6dA9BwqB5HazYzyavWEjDrh6LGMFsvW
transaction
33bfd515106a37effbbc4859d5eceb3a5fcb3f8557abd1412e8a2d86e42a0394
spent
true